Reconstruction of drip-water &delta;<sup>18</sup>O based on calcite oxygen and clumped isotopes of speleothems from Bunker Cave (Germany)

The geochemical signature of many speleothems used for reconstruction of past continental climates is affected by kinetic isotope fractionation.
